Would you’re keen on to understand the secrets of search engine optimisation?  Here’s a seven step guide to improving your ranking within the search engines.  

First you would like to find what individuals are looking for when they visit your site.  Researching what actual words individuals type in to search engines is very important, these are your “keywords”.  

Do your analysis on your keywords using Overture and Wordtracker.  Overture can tell you how several people are looking out on explicit words or phrases.  Wordtracker provides you an idea how much competition there is for those keywords.

Once you’ve got your list of keywords, then you’re prepared to optimise your website.  I say keywords as, with increasing competition on the web, you’re more likely to possess success with keyword phrases or a cluster of keywords, than with simply one keyword.  

There are just seven straightforward steps:-

1.    Name your web site appropriately – if your site is regarding cat food, then embrace the keywords “cat food” in the title of your website
2.    Guarantee that your keywords are included in the page title
3.    Add a Header tag using H1 tags
4.    Use your keyword in the first line & last line of your content
5.    Add an Alt Tag to your footage which includes a description of the image and includes your keywords
6.    Guarantee that your keyword is included within the outbound links from your website, an easy manner to do this is often to link the page back to itself.
7.    Sprinkle your keyword a pair additional times throughout your text and guarantee that you’ve got at least 250 words on the page.  If you can’t write this a lot of, then write an introduction and then add a free article from one of the Article Directories, such as Ezine Articles.  

If you embody most of those on every of your pages,  you’ll realize that you must move up in the search engine rankings over time.  

All of those strategies are what’s called “on page” optimisation.  

You’ll be able to also optimise “off page” by building links to your website, using one of the many link swapping sites available.  

You’ll be able to conjointly create quality links to your web site is by leaving comments after you visit alternative folks’s blogs.  When leaving a comment, guarantee {that the} “name” you leave includes your keyword, where doable, and a link back to your site.  For instance, you could leave a comment from “Jo @ Cat foods”, linking back to your web site address.  If you are not certain where to find relevant blogs, either sort in your keyword and also the word “blog” into any of the search engines, or visit Blogger . com  and run a hunt for your keywords.

Another great approach of creating links to your web site, is by writing and submitting articles to sites like Ezine Articles.com  making certain {that a} link to your own web site is entered in the Resource Box.

You’ll not see immediate results from your efforts, however with patience you may realize that you see a lot of guests returning to your website as your rankings within the search engines improve.
